The colors used in our khadi matka silk kurtas are chosen carefully to reflect the symbolism of Indian culture. For example, red signifies strength and love, often worn during weddings; green is associated with new beginnings and prosperity, perfect for festivals like Diwali. Each hue adds a touch of auspiciousness to your attire, making it ideal for traditional celebrations.
